The Shri Trivati Nath Temple is one of the six ancient temples devoted to Lord Shiva. Situated in Bareilly, at the temple of Lord Shiva, also known as Trivati Nath,. The temple earned its name, Trivati Nath, due to the presence of a Shivling between three banyan trees. Maha Shivratri, Ganesh Chaturthi, Janmashtami and Navratri are important festivals celebrated at this temple.
